Shadow Daemon – Modular Web Application Firewall

Shadow Daemon is a collection of open source tools to detect, record and prevent attacks on web applications. In other words, Shadow Daemon is a web application firewall that intercepts requests and filters out malicious parameters. Shadow Daemon is a

Read more

Hackety Hack – programming software

Hackety Hack is an open source application that teaches individuals how to create software from the absolute basics. It combines an Integrated Development Environment with an extensive Lessons system. Hackety Hack is a programming starter kit. It is an editor

Read more

GitHub – configuration management system

GitHub is currently the world’s largest, and most popular code hosting site. It is web-based and uses Git, an open-source version control system that was started by Linus Torvalds, the principal force behind the Linux kernel. GitHub provides distributed revision

Read more

Open-Sankore – interactive whiteboard

Open-Sankoré is an open source interactive white board that uses a free standard format compatible with any projector and pointing device. With an ergonomic interface, it combines the simplicity of traditional teaching tools with the advantages provided by teaching ICTs.

Read more

Flickr Photo Downloader – download Flickr images

Flickr Photo Downloader is a small, open source utility written in the Java programming language which lets users download Flickr images from public profiles. To download images from a public profile, you only need to know the Flickr account name,

Read more

Prototype – JavaScript framework

The Prototype JavaScript Framework is a JavaScript framework that aims to ease development of dynamic web applications. It is implemented as a single file of JavaScript code, usually named prototype.js. It offers a familiar class-style OO framework, extensive Ajax support,

Read more

Omnitux – various educational activities

Omnitux is a set of educational activities based on multimedia elements (images, sounds, and text). Omnitux provides various different activity types including associations, puzzles and counting. Omnitux activities are described in relatively simple XML files. Therefore, people without programming skills

Read more

phpGroupWare – groupware suite written in PHP

phpGroupWare (formerly known as webdistro) is a multi-user groupware suite written in PHP and part of the DotGNU project. It provides about 50 web-based applications including a Calendar, Addressbook, an advanced Project manager, Todo List, Email, and File manager. These

Read more

Eukleides – geometry drawing language

Eukleides is a language which allows one to typeset geometric figures within a (La)TeX document. It aims to be a fairly comprehensive system to create geometric figures, either static or dynamic. It allows to handle basic types of data: numbers

Read more

Emacs – editor and lots more

GNU Emacs is an extensible, customizable, self-documenting text editor. Emacs is a highly advanced text editor, providing users with much more than simple insertion and deletion. This large, complex application does everything from editing text to functioning as a complete

Read more

Diakonos – editor for the masses

Diakonos is a customizable, usable console-based text editor. It has the aim of being easier to configure and use than emacs, more powerful than pico and nano, and not as cryptic as vi or ex. Diakonos uses the standard Macintosh/Windows

Read more